Mark and Lois began ministry in Latin America in March 1975. Three days after their wedding, they were headed for Mexico as missionaries. In March 1976 Mark began serving in Guatemala and the family moved there in August of that year. In 1981 the Simpsons were off again, this time to the Amazon jungles of Peru. GOLIATH AND SAUL by Mark Simpson, Founder/President

Two giants in David’s life. Giants, adversaries, but different.

Goliath, defeated and decapitated in one day.

Saul, an ongoing, seeming to be never-ending conflict that lasted approximately seventeen years.

We wish all of our spiritual battles got dealt with as fast as that stone dealt with Goliath’s huge head.

But it is not always like that. The battle against Goliath came from someone who knew nothing about David until it was too late.
Saul, on the other hand, was being used by the enemy to isolate David. To insult him, and accuse him. To cut him off, from his parents, his wife, his best friend. To keep him separated from family, as the powerful and intelligent principalities and powers working against him through the life and influence of Saul went on and on with apparently no end in sight.

We pray for our loved ones, as David prayed for his father-in-law Saul. But Saul never responded to any of those prayers, except for occasional emotional outbursts of “Yes, David, you are right! You are righteous, and I have been foolish!” Those brief outbursts were followed by more jealous fury and rage and divisive tactics, knowing, as Satan knows well, that a house divided against itself cannot stand. How will David be able to stand when I have isolated him from all that is supposed to support and encourage him—even isolating him from God’s house that he loves so much?

DIRTY TACTICS
This is how Satan plays. Dirty. No rules, no conscience, no acknowledgement of God’s word, just an outward, do’s and don’ts religion covering over deep jealousy and bitterness and a complete refusal to forgive as we have been forgiven, or to confess and apologize. “Confess and pray for each other that you might be healed,” James tells us: a totally ignored verse by many. I am a participant in a large, nationwide Facebook support group called Christian Parents of Estranged Adult Children. There are millions in this group! The accounts of brokenhearted parents and grandparents are a literal multitude, and sometimes their stories and cries for prayer are devastating beyond description.

No doubt about it: the “Stronghold of Saul” is a powerful enemy of the body of Christ—worse than Goliath, if you can imagine! It went on for so many years in David’s life that in I Samuel 27 he gave up for a season and went to live with the enemy. God did restore him, even through the additional heartbreak of seeing his beloved family members die on the field of battle rather than turn and be reconciled. He lost his best friend and brother-in-law Jonathan through all this. The losses from this spiritual stronghold have been immense.

River of life in partnership with Missions to the Amazon (for 22 years now) just concluded teaching class #10 of our Bible School for leaders. 120 students from 30 different Peruvian Amazon villages. We use Zoom and live instructors, a great team! Course 11 is in May, and in November these workers will graduate!

First missionary to be sent from the United States

Over 200 years ago, Adoniram Judson and his wife and family left for India. They wound up in Burma. His translation of the Bible into Burmese permanently impacted this nation (now Myanmar).
